The Maintenance Planner/Scheduler optimizes the efficiency of the Maintenance Department by providing short term and long-term planning/scheduling that increases work output while minimizing wasted effort.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for estimating time and specifying materials, equipment, and manpower on maintenance work orders.
  • Coordinate parts and materials availability with work orders to allow timely completion of maintenance tasks.
  • Schedule and plan preventive, routine maintenance, and shutdown work activities.
  • Responsible for managing data input into the work order system.
  • Responsible for managing a work order backlog.
  • Assist in forecasting contractor manpower requirements and track and report daily manpower usage when needed.
  • Write purchase order requisitions and contractor service agreements.
  • Review work order requests and correct deficiencies.
  • Communicate with operations to effectively plan and schedule work in accordance with their needs and their operating schedules.
  • Complete safe work permits for contractors.
  • Attend mechanic’s morning meeting to get feedback, adjust schedule, and be informed of emergency jobs.
